What Types of Filters Does a Semi Truck Use?
A semi-truck can contain several independent filtration systems.
Common examples include:
- Engine air filters
- Engine oil filters
- Primary fuel filters
- Secondary fuel filters
- Fuel-water separators
- Cabin air filters
- Hydraulic filters
- Transmission filters
- Crankcase ventilation filters
- Air dryer cartridges
Each filter protects a different system.
An engine air filter keeps abrasive airborne contaminants away from the engine. An oil filter removes particles from circulating lubricant. Fuel filters protect pumps and injectors, while cabin filters clean air entering the driver’s HVAC system.

Which Semi Truck Filters Brand Is Best?
There is no single filter brand that is automatically the best choice for every semi-truck.
Different vehicles can require different:
- Filter dimensions
- Media specifications
- Flow rates
- Pressure capabilities
- Micron ratings
- Water-separation performance
- Bypass-valve settings
- Housing designs
- Sensor connections
A suitable filter from MANN-FILTER may be available for one application, while a HENGST or MAHLE reference may suit another.
For fleet operators managing different makes and engine platforms, using multiple reputable filter brands can therefore be completely normal.
The important factor is application compatibility.
1. Start With the OE Filter Reference
The original equipment reference is one of the most useful starting points when sourcing a replacement filter.
An OE number can help identify compatible aftermarket references and reduce the risk of ordering a filter intended for a different engine or filtration system.
When requesting a filter, provide information such as:
- OE part number
- Existing filter reference
- Truck make
- Truck model
- Engine model
- Model year where relevant
The more accurate the application information, the easier it is to identify the correct replacement.
2. Compare Filtration Requirements, Not Appearance
Two filters can have similar external dimensions but perform very differently.
Important specifications may include:
Filtration Efficiency
The filter must remove contaminants at the level required by the protected system.
Flow Capacity
Air, fuel, oil or hydraulic fluid must be able to pass through the filter at the required rate.
Dirt-Holding Capacity
Filters need sufficient capacity to retain contamination throughout their intended service interval.
Operating Pressure
Oil, fuel, hydraulic and transmission filters may operate under very different pressure conditions.
Sealing
The filter must seal correctly within its housing. Contaminated fluid or air bypassing the filter media defeats the purpose of filtration.
Selecting a filter simply because it “looks the same” can therefore be risky.

4. Consider the Truck’s Operating Conditions
A filter operates within the environment of the truck.
Filter requirements can be influenced by:
- Dust exposure
- Road conditions
- Climate
- Fuel quality
- Vehicle load
- Engine hours
- Idling time
- Stop-start operation
- Long-distance highway operation
- Vocational use
A truck working daily on a dusty construction site experiences different air-filter loading from a long-haul vehicle operating primarily on paved highways.
Similarly, poor or inconsistent diesel quality can affect the loading of fuel filters and water separators.
The brand matters, but the application and maintenance environment determine how the filtration system performs in service.
5. Do Not Choose Filters Based Only on Price
Filter price is important for fleet operating costs, particularly when dozens or hundreds of vehicles require routine servicing.
However, purchase price should be considered alongside:
- Correct application
- Filtration specification
- Service life
- Availability
- Reliability
- Fleet standardisation
- Supplier support
A filter that is inexpensive but incorrectly specified can expose components worth far more than the saving made on the filter.
For procurement teams, the better objective is usually to achieve the correct balance between technical suitability, availability and total maintenance cost.
Should a Fleet Standardise Its Filter Brands?
Standardising filter suppliers can simplify fleet maintenance, but only when suitable references are available for the vehicles involved.
Potential benefits include:
- Easier purchasing
- Fewer suppliers
- Simplified stock management
- More consistent workshop procedures
- Easier filter cross-referencing
- More predictable inventory planning
However, a mixed fleet may contain different truck makes, engine generations and filtration systems.
It can therefore make sense to use MANN-FILTER for certain applications, HENGST for others and MAHLE where another suitable reference is available.
Technical fitment should take priority over forcing every vehicle onto one filter brand.
